ADA Standards and Reception Desk Height
* The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) doesn't specify an exact height for reception desks. Instead, it focuses on ensuring *accessible features* are available.
* The key is providing a counter that allows wheelchair users to comfortably interact with staff.
* The ADA Standards for Accessible Design recommends a maximum height of 36 inches (91.4 cm) for counters. This allows for comfortable interaction from a seated position.
* However, providing lower counters at specific locations within the reception area is considered a best practice. This promotes inclusivity and ensures a variety of interaction heights are possible.

Designing for Inclusivity
* Lower Counters: Incorporate lower counters or portions of counters at a height accessible to wheelchair users.
* Clearance: Ensure adequate knee clearance (at least 27 inches high, 30 inches wide, and 19 inches deep) beneath any counter.
* Approach: Allow for ample approach space to the desk, free of obstacles, according to ADA guidelines.
* Communication: Ensure that information displays (e.g., menus, signage) are viewable from both seated and standing positions.
